Ambassa Residents Protest Poor Development, Submit Memorandum to Council Chairman

Residents of TRTC Para in Ward 6 of the Ambassa Municipal Council of Dhalai District have raised their voices over the deteriorating condition of their area. 

Facing multiple issues including poor roads, inadequate drinking water, and defective drainage systems, the local community has demanded urgent action from the municipal authorities.

On Tuesday, the residents of TRTC Para gathered and submitted a memorandum to the Chairman of the Ambassa Municipal Council, presenting three key demands. Leading the delegation, Samrat Basak told reporters that despite paying taxes regularly, the residents of TRTC Para have received no facilities or improvements from the municipal council.

“The development in our ward has come to a standstill. Roads, drinking water, and drainage repairs have not been addressed,” Basak said. He added that if their demands are not met, the residents are prepared to launch a larger protest in the future.

Locals also alleged widespread corruption in the area, implicating several political figures. Despite these issues, the administration has not initiated any investigation, fueling frustration among residents.
